The claim was struck out because, on the face of the pleadings and affidavits, the payments were made by the firm to the defendant as nominee of WLH under a contract between the firm and WLH (thus the payments were for WLH); plaintiff failed to satisfy the conditions for restitution under s71 (payments were not made for plaintiff or for defendant as donee) and plaintiff lacked locus standi to sue in his personal capacity as the firm, not plaintiff personally, bore any loss; the claim was therefore untenable, frivolous and an abuse of process.
